Nokia May Sell Luxury Phone Brand Vertu For $200 Million

Screen shot 2012-06-13 at 9.55.21 AMNokia is reportedly in talks with a private equity group called EQT in an attempt to sell off its independent subsidiary, Vertu. Vertu, if you don't already know, is an ultra-luxury phone brand that operates independently within Nokia that makes high-end phones with stainless steel, ceramics, carbon fiber, and even alligator skin and finest grade leather, with sapphires and rubies as buttons.That said, Reuters reports that the Vertu price tag is around $200 million.
